简介
raptor-logging是一个用于JavaScript的轻量级日志框架。它提供了强大的日志记录功能,可以将日志输出到控制台、文件或任意其他目标。本文将详细介绍如何在前端项目中使用raptor-logging。
安装
你可以通过npm安装raptor-logging:
npm install raptor-logging
使用
基本用法
const logger = require('raptor-logging').logger; logger.info('Hello, world!');
上面的代码将输出一条信息“Hello, world!”到控制台。raptor-logging内置5个不同级别的日志记录方法:trace()
, debug()
, info()
, warn()
和 error()
。
配置
设置日志级别
你可以通过以下方式来设置日志级别:
const logger = require('raptor-logging').logger; logger.setLevel('debug');
上面的代码将设置为debug级别,这意味着所有级别高于debug的记录都将被记录下来。
更改日志格式
你可以通过以下方式更改日志格式:
const logger = require('raptor-logging').logger; logger.setFormat('[${level}] ${time} ${message}');
上面的代码将设置日志格式为“[级别] 时间 信息”。
输出到文件
你可以通过以下方式将日志输出到文件:
const FileTarget = require('raptor-logging/target/FileTarget'); const logger = require('raptor-logging').logger; logger.addTarget(new FileTarget('/path/to/log/file.log'));
上面的代码将日志输出到名为“file.log”的文件中。
总结
在本文中,我们介绍了如何在前端项目中使用raptor-logging。我们讨论了安装、基本用法和配置,并提供了示例代码。我希望这篇文章能对你有所帮助,使你可以更好地记录和管理你的应用程序日志。
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/44843